About the Service
This private facility offers acute mental health and addiction inpatient treatment within a 35-bed hospital. It also provides a strong day and outpatient programme with a range of therapeutic interventions such as CBT, art therapy, DBT, and EMDR. At times, some private beds are utilised by the NHS when there are no available beds within NHS trusts.
